How they compare
Gabon currently reports 318.46 infections against 299.75 infections in Dominican Republic, a difference of 18.71 infections.
That makes Gabon's figure about 1.1 times Dominican Republic's.
The two have swapped places 3 times across 35 shared years of data; in 1990 it was Dominican Republic ahead.
Dominican Republic ranks 40th and Gabon ranks 39th of 86 countries.
Across the 4 decades both report, Dominican Republic averaged higher in 3 and Gabon in 1.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Dominican Republic | Gabon |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 1,122 infections | 539.1 infections | 582.88 infections | Dominican Republic |
| 2000s | 922.68 infections | 861.9 infections | 60.77 infections | Dominican Republic |
| 2010s | 552.93 infections | 579.6 infections | 26.67 infections | Gabon |
| 2020s | 428.37 infections | 361.12 infections | 67.25 infections | Dominican Republic |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
Number of people aged 0-14 newly infected with HIV in the last 12 months. This is the central estimate.
